In reinforced cement concrete (RCC) work, 2-legged stirrups refer to a type of reinforcement used to provide structural support and improve the shear strength of beams and slabs. They consist of two vertical legs connected by horizontal ties, forming a closed loop that helps confine the concrete and prevent cracking. This configuration enhances the overall stability of the concrete structure by effectively resisting shear forces and tensile stresses. Proper placement and detailing of stirrups are crucial for ensuring the integrity and durability of the RCC elements.

What do you mean by 4 and 6 stirrups leg in rcc design?

In reinforced cement concrete (RCC) design, "4 and 6 stirrups leg" refers to the configuration of stirrups used in beams or columns. A "4-leg stirrup" consists of four vertical legs that provide confinement and shear reinforcement, while a "6-leg stirrup" has six legs. The choice between these configurations depends on the structural requirements, such as load-carrying capacity and shear resistance, with more legs typically enhancing the structural integrity and stability of the element.
